The Vital Role of Dental Specialists
Dental specialists, ranging from orthodontists to periodontists, focus on specific areas of oral health, offering targeted treatments that go beyond general dentistry. Orthodontists, for instance, correct misaligned teeth and jaws, improving both aesthetics and oral function, while periodontists specialize in the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of gum diseases. Regular visits to these specialists are crucial, as they can identify issues early, preventing more severe complications down the line. Advancements in Dental Care
Innovations in dental technology are transforming the landscape of oral health care, making procedures more efficient and less invasive. Through the use of digital imaging, laser dentistry, and minimally invasive techniques, dentists can provide higher-quality treatments with reduced recovery times. These advancements not only enhance patient comfort but also improve the accuracy of diagnoses and the effectiveness of treatments.
